MANCHESTER VT 1/RNW A509L/8: Alistair Macdonald, snf, talking to Den Dover, Conservative MP for Chorley, about why he voted against the Government last night over plans to cut back the money the council can spend from the sale of council houses. 03m27s VT 1/RNW A509L/9: Richard Duckenfield, snf, talking to Dave Ashley, Managing Director of JBA Engineering, about the unveiling of their new prototype car - the Javelin. Incl. 16mm film of the car and the previous one, the Falcon. Commag. Ward. (Dick oov) 28ft 00m45s TOTAL VT DUR: 04m17s VT 1/RNW A509L/10: Mike Amat, from Harwood, talking about his pet dog and cat, Mop & Smiff, about which he has based a new children’s series. Dave Guest, snf, spoke to Anne Miller, Postwoman. PSC. Park. (Incl. excerpt from an episode. 01m09s) 03m01s Incl. 16mm film from an episode of the series. Sepmag. 19ft 00m30s TOTAL VT DUR: 03m31s PSC: 1. Julie Carter, snf, talking to Trevor Knowles, from Rimmington, who’s partially paralyzed, about the difficulties he has had to overcome in the field of rally driving. Higginson. 03m16s

1 Film of hunt saboteurs at Altcar. Dave Callender, Merseyside Hunt Saboteurs, talked about the end of the Waterloo Cup. Commag. Ward. (Stu oov) 0 mins 41 secs
2 Film of the cleaners’ strike at the Atomic Energy Authority. BBC Stock. (John oov) 0 mins 26 secs
